Why Electronics Freight Needs Its Own Page

Electronics loads often sit in an awkward middle ground. They are not always regulated like pharmaceuticals or chemicals, but they can still be highly targeted, fragile and commercially sensitive. That makes a broad electronics page useful for users whose intent is clearly about valuable device freight rather than standard haulage.

Cargo Value

High Value In Small Space

A relatively compact consignment can still represent major loss value, which makes theft prevention and custody controls disproportionately important.

Condition Risk

Damage May Not Be Obvious

Shock, mishandling, crush damage and packaging failure may only become visible later, which can make electronics claims more disputed than ordinary freight losses.

Customer Sensitivity

Short Delays Still Hurt

Electronics shipments are often tied to launches, retail cycles, installations or reseller timelines, so even short disruption can create wider commercial pressure.

Claim Scenarios Electronics Carriers Worry About

Theft From Vehicle Or Yard

Electronics loads are often targeted because the resale market is broad, which means route security and overnight controls quickly become central to the discussion.

Handling Damage In Transit

Even if the pallet looks intact, internal device damage can still create a claim after delivery when the consignee starts testing units.

Retail Or Reseller Dispute

A short shipment, seal issue or unexplained carton discrepancy can become a significant claim where branded electronics are involved.
